Bills Hire New Offensive Assistant

The Bills have named Nathaniel Hackett as their offensive quality control coach.  Hackett, who spent the last two years in Tampa Bay, has worked with quarterback Trent Edwards in the past.  He was on the Stanford coaching staff for three of Edwards four years on the team.  The Bills still have two positions to fill, [...]

DE Hargrove Suspended for One-Year

The Bills have lost one of their big men for the 2008 season, as DE Anthony Hargrove is gone after violating the league’s substance abuse policy a third time.  It was the second time since August that Hargrove had voilated the policy.  This past season Hargrove played in 12 games, making 28 total tackles to [...]

Bills Promote Brandon, Will Handle GM Duties

The Bills have promoted from within, in their search for a new general manager.  Ralph Wilson Jr. has chosen Executive Vice President Russ Brandon to become the new Chief Operating Officer.  Brandon has spent the last 11 years with the Bills and will now handle all football and business operations.  Brandon will be the fourth lead [...]

Everett Receives Bills’ Courage Award

The Bills have named Kevin Everett as their Ed Block Courage Award winner.  The award is given to a player who shows commitment, courage, professionalism and dedication.  Everett suffered a spinal cord injury at the beginning of the season and now is able to walk without assistance.  Past recipients include Jim Kelly, Bruce Smith, Steve [...]
